The Healthy Age Friendly Homes Mid-West team attended the ‘Seenager Information Morning’ hosted by West Limerick Resources. The purpose of this event was to target older adults in West Limerick and provide them with information talks and information brochures from the various stands that were there.

HAFH Stand
Karen presentation

The event was held in the Longcourt Hotel in Newcastle West, Co. Limerick and attended by our Regional Programme Manager for the Mid-West, Karen Fennessy and Limerick Coordinator Jillian Robinson. There was a good attendance by older people living in the area and lots of interest at the HAFH stand.

At the event, there were some great information talks on the following subjects which were beneficial to all.

  • Claire Flynn – Mental Health Ireland ‘Continuing Positive mental health throughout our Life’
  • Michelle Gilbourne Solicitor – ‘Getting legal ready for the 3rd Act’
  • Karen Fenessy – Regional Programme Manager Mid-West ‘Healthy Age Friendly Homes Programme’
  • Marie O’Connor – Local Link Limerick – ‘Rural Transport Limerick – Keeping you connected’
